# Idempotency keys for payment retries — Lumenpay gateway
# When the Trestlework checkout service retries a failed charge, it must reuse
# the same idempotency key so the Lumenpay gateway deduplicates the request
# rather than double-billing the customer. Keys are derived from the order ID
# plus attempt epoch, then signed with a shared secret before transmission.
# Reviewers: confirm the derivation matches gateway-side validation, and that
# rotation is coordinated with the Lumenpay ops rota. The signing secret is
# set on the next line.

sealed setting: LEDGER_TOKEN13=5d842615a26d7

Runbook: ChipGate Reader Recovery (Lakeford Marathon). If the mat reader drops RFID reads below 95%, restart the antenna multiplexer service before touching firmware. Verify the split-feed daemon reconnects to the scoring bus within 30 seconds; otherwise fail over to the backup reader at the finish arch. Confirm timestamps are monotonic across both units before re-enabling live results. Record the firmware revision in the incident log. The build token for the active reader image appears below.

pipeline stamp: htk21_104c5ba7d0df6b2897cd5

Step 4 — Patch the Lumagrid image cache leak. The LRU in `tilecache.go` never evicted decoded bitmaps when the resize worker errored; RSS grew ~200MB/hour on the render fleet. Fix adds a deferred evict plus a hard cap of 4k entries. Deploy to canary pods in the Vexbury region first, watch heap for 30 minutes, then roll fleet-wide. Do not restart workers mid-batch; drain them. Sign the build artifact before pushing to the registry using the deploy key below.

deploy key for kajof-fajop: bky6_gDHw9Q

MEMO — Discount Policy for Large Deals

From: Commercial Office, Vantrell Systems
To: Heads of Department

Quick heads-up: we're tightening discounting on deals above the Tier 3 threshold. Anything over 18% off list on the Corvex suite now needs sign-off from Elsa or Bram — no exceptions, even for renewals. The old regional carve-outs are gone as of next month. Rationale and templates are on the intranet. The confidential note below explains the business plan driving this change.

confidential, kahag-fafof: Pelixax Holdings is in early talks to buy Praixox Group for about $24.9 million. The Oliir launch date is March 8, and nothing goes to the press before then.